PortionPal account recovery follows a fixed sequence. Verify the requester owns the scaling-profile workspace, then reset their session tokens from the admin console. If the console itself is locked, restore access using the maintainer vault. The vault accepts the standing recovery passphrase, which is listed directly below this paragraph.

unlock words, hahip-yagef: zorok-novmir-zorix-silax

MergeWell's dedupe engine scores record pairs on normalized name, postal fragment, and fuzzy contact similarity. Plugin authors can register custom matchers via the comparator hook, but scores above 0.92 always trigger an automatic merge unless your plugin vetoes it explicitly. Vetoed pairs land in the review queue for the Tandrel Ops team. If your plugin's merge history becomes corrupted, you can restore the comparator state from the sealed vault, which unlocks with the recovery passphrase below.

unlock words, yawig-kagef: gordor-holvan-ulaael-pramir-ulaiel-tamdor

**Q: How do I force cache invalidation for the Pellworth catalog?**

Stale product entries usually mean the Hearthcache TTL fanout failed. Purge the catalog namespace, then replay the pricing feed. If the purge endpoint refuses your token, unlock the maintainer vault instead. The recovery passphrase for that vault is listed directly below.

unlock words, hahip-baduf: holwyn-istath-julvan

Before adding any font to the Mistral Design System repository, you must obtain approval — no exceptions, even for internal tools. Font licenses vary widely, and several restrict redistribution or embedding, which directly affects our Lanternwood desktop builds. To request approval: attach the full license text, note the exact use case (UI, print, marketing), and confirm whether subsetting is planned, since some licenses forbid modification. Keep the license file vendored beside the font. All requests go to the approver named below.

named custodian: Belius Casath Ulaix Sorius